Robust sales lift Adidas Q3 net profit

SPORTSWEAR maker Adidas AG yesterday posted a 25-percent rise in third-quarter earnings, helped by strong demand for football products and a return to growth in its Chinese business, and raised its full-year outlook.

Adidas said it made a net profit of 266 million euros (US$373 million) from July to September, up from 213 million euros a year ago.

Revenues climbed 20 percent to 3.47 billion euros from 2.89 billion euros. In currency-neutral terms, Adidas said revenues were up 10 percent; the euro traded above this year's levels in the third quarter of 2009.

The company raised its earnings forecasts for the full-year and now expects sales to increase by about 8 percent on a currency-neutral basis, up from a previous forecast of a mid-single-digit rise.

It pointed to "positive effects" from this year's football World Cup.
